Asus Zenfone 4 Is Available For Pre-Order On Flipkart

Asus unveiled their Zenfone 4 device last month. The latter one is now available for pre-order on Flipkart for Rs. 6999 (approximately $115). Zenfone 4 is running Android 4.4 KitKat with Asus’ very own Zen UI on top of it. The device is sporting a 4.5-inch (854 x 480) display on the front along with the usual sensors and a 0.3-megapixel camera which are also located on the front of this device. Zenfone 4 is powered by Intel Atom Z2520 dual-core processor clocked at 1.2GHz and PowerVR SGX544 GPU is here for graphics performance as well as 1GB of RAM for your multitasking needs. On the back of the device you’ll find an 8-megapixel camera as well as a LED flash. This is a Dual SIM device (Micro SIMs) and is 11.3mm thick while it weights 134g. 1750mAh battery is here to make sure you don’t run out of juice in the middle of the day and note that this is a 3G device. If you decide to purchase one, it will ship in the first week of September.
